IN THE CIRCUIT COURT OF MILLER COUNTY, ARKANSAS BEN A. HATRIDGE, JR. PLAINTIFF vs. SUSHIL GAURIAR, RANI GAURIAR, and THE INTERNAL REVENUE SERVICE DEFENDANTS NOTICE OF FORECLOSURE SALE CASE NO. CV-2007-401-3 N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N, that pursuant to the authority and directions contained in the order of the Chancery Court of Miller County, Arkansas, entered on February 7, 2008, in Cause No. CV-2007-401-3 between Ben A. Hatridge, Plaintiff, and Sushil and Rani Guariar and the Internal Revenue Service, Defendants, Mary Pankey, Circuit Court Clerk, the undersigned, as Commissioner of such Court, will offer for public sale to the highest bidder at the south door or entrance of the Miller County Courthouse at 10:00 o’clock a.m., on the 25th day of March, 2008, the following described real estate located in Miller County, Arkansas: All that certain parcel of land being a part of the Southwest Quarter of the Southwest Quarter (SW 1/4 SW 1/4) of Section Thirty-four (34), Township Fifteen (15) South, Range Twenty-eight (28) West, Miller County, Arkansas, and described by meted and bounds as follows: COMMENCING at the Northwest corner of said SW 1/4 SW 1/4, Section 34, T 15 S., R. 28 W.; THENCE: run South 269 ft. to the Point of Beginning; THENCE: run East 313.82 ft. to a point; THENCE: run South 715.4 ft. to a point on the North boundary line of a 6.75 acre tract conveyed to Gary Dodd, et ux, recorded in Vol. D-325, Page 700, Deed Records, Miller County, Arkansas; THENCE: West along the North boundary line of said Dodd tract a distance of 313.82 ft; THENCE: North 715.4 ft. to the Point of Beginning, containing 5.15 acres of land, more or less. TERMS OF SALE: On a credit of three months, the purchaser being required to execute a bond as required by law and the order of the Court, with approved security, bearing interest at the rate of ten percent (10%) per annum from date of sale until paid, and a lien being retained on the premises sold to secure the payment of the purchaser money. Given under my hand this 19th day of February, 2008. Mary Pankey Commissioner of Court
